IN THE UNITED STATES DISTRICT COURT FOR THE MIDDLE DISTRICT OF PENNSYLVANIA : : : : : : : : : KENNETH R. REID, et al., Plaintiffs, v. WARDEN J. EBBERT, et al., Defendants. Civil No. 1:16-cv-1403 Judge Sylvia H. Rambo ORDER Before the court is a report and recommendation of the magistrate judge (Doc. 125) in which he recommends that all claims against the defendant identified in the complaint as Lt. Condozer be dismissed without prejudice pursuant to Federal Rule of Civil Procedure 4(m) for Plaintiffs’ failure to provide the court with sufficient information to effectuate service on Lt. Condozer. Objections were due on August 1, 2018, and to date, no objections have been filed. Accordingly, IT IS HEREBY ORDERED as follows: 1) The report and recommendation of the magistrate judge is ADOPTED. 2) All claims against the defendant identified in the complaint as “Lt. Condozer” are DISMISSED without prejudice pursuant to Fed. R. Civ. P. 4(m). 3) The Clerk of Court shall remand this matter back to the magistrate judge for any further proceedings. s/Sylvia H. Rambo SYLVIA H. RAMBO United States District Judge Dated: September 5, 2018
